The post accurately cites Statistics Canada data showing 267,626 deaths among Canadians aged 60+ in 2024, combined with a March 2026 Abacus Data poll revealing 57% Liberal and 29% Conservative vote intentions in that group, leading to an estimated 152,000 Liberal-affiliated and 78,000 Conservative-affiliated deaths.
